数据清洗

2025-04-07 08:06:26
2 阅读
数据清洗

数据清洗

数据清洗是数据处理过程中的一个重要环节,主要目的是提高数据质量,为后续的数据分析和挖掘提供准确可靠的基础。随着信息技术的飞速发展,数据的产生速度和数量大幅增加,数据清洗的重要性愈发凸显。本文将从数据清洗的定义、过程、方法、工具、应用领域及其在AI和智能办公中的具体应用进行详细探讨。

在科技飞速发展的今天,人工智能(AI)技术已经深刻改变了办公领域的工作方式。本课程专为企业各部门的专业人士设计,旨在帮助学员掌握ChatGPT等AI工具,提高办公效率。通过理论讲解与实操演练相结合,学员将深入了解ChatGPT的
wangxiaowei 王小伟 培训咨询

一、数据清洗的定义

数据清洗,亦称为数据清理或数据净化,是指在数据分析过程中,通过一系列的技术和算法,对原始数据中的错误、重复、不完整和不一致信息进行识别和修正的过程。数据清洗的核心目标是确保数据的准确性、一致性和完整性,从而为后续的数据分析、挖掘和建模提供高质量的数据支持。

在大数据时代,企业和组织通常会收集大量的数据,这些数据往往来自不同的渠道和系统,格式各异且质量参差不齐。通过有效的数据清洗,可以消除噪声数据,提高数据的可用性,进而增强数据驱动决策的能力。

二、数据清洗的过程

数据清洗的过程通常包括以下几个步骤:

  • 数据收集:从不同的数据源收集原始数据,包括数据库、日志文件、传感器数据、网络爬虫等。
  • 数据审查:对收集到的数据进行初步审查,识别数据中的错误、缺失、重复和异常值。
  • 数据修正:对识别出的问题数据进行相应的修正,包括填补缺失值、去除重复记录、处理异常值等。
  • 数据标准化:将数据转换为统一的格式和标准,例如统一数据单位、时间格式、分类标准等。
  • 数据验证:对清洗后的数据进行验证,确保数据的准确性和完整性。
  • 数据存储:将清洗后的数据存储在合适的数据库或数据仓库中,以便后续的分析和使用。

三、数据清洗的方法

数据清洗的方法多种多样,常见的方法包括:

  • 缺失值处理:对缺失值进行填补、删除或插值处理。常用方法包括均值填补、中位数填补、插值法等。
  • 重复数据处理:识别并去除数据集中重复的记录。可以使用哈希算法或相似度匹配算法进行处理。
  • 异常值检测:通过统计分析方法(如Z-score、箱线图等)识别数据中的异常值,并决定是否进行剔除或修正。
  • 数据格式转换:将数据转换为适合分析的格式,包括日期格式转换、文本编码转换等。
  • 标准化和归一化:对数据进行标准化处理,使其具有相同的尺度,便于后续的分析和建模。

四、数据清洗的工具

在数据清洗过程中,使用合适的工具能够极大提高工作效率。常见的数据清洗工具包括:

  • Python:Python具有强大的数据处理库,如Pandas、NumPy等,能够高效地进行数据清洗和处理。
  • R语言:R语言拥有丰富的统计分析和数据处理包,如dplyr、tidyr等,适合进行复杂的数据清洗任务。
  • OpenRefine:一款开源的数据清洗工具,适合处理结构化和半结构化数据,支持数据的转换和整理。
  • Excel:对于小规模的数据集,Excel提供了便捷的数据处理和清洗功能,通过公式、筛选和排序可快速识别和处理问题数据。
  • Talend:一款强大的ETL(提取、转换、加载)工具,支持数据清洗、集成和转换,适合企业级数据处理。

五、数据清洗的应用领域

数据清洗在多个领域中得到了广泛应用,主要包括:

  • 金融行业:在金融行业,数据清洗被用于处理客户数据、交易数据等,以确保数据的准确性和合规性。
  • 医疗行业:医疗数据的准确性对于患者的诊断和治疗至关重要,数据清洗可用于处理病历数据、实验室数据等。
  • 市场营销:市场营销部门利用清洗过的数据进行客户细分、市场分析和营销活动优化。
  • 电商领域:电商平台通过数据清洗优化商品信息、客户评价和订单数据,提升用户体验。
  • 政府和公共服务:政府机构通过数据清洗提高公共服务的数据质量,增强决策的科学性。

六、数据清洗在AI和智能办公中的应用

在AI和智能办公的背景下,数据清洗显得尤为重要。AI模型的训练和应用需要高质量的数据作为基础,而数据清洗则是确保数据质量的第一步。以下是数据清洗在AI和智能办公中的具体应用:

1. 助力AI模型训练

在机器学习和深度学习的过程中,数据清洗可以帮助去除噪声数据和异常值,从而提高模型的准确性与泛化能力。高质量的数据能够使训练出的模型更具鲁棒性,减少过拟合现象。

2. 改善数据输入的准确性

在智能办公环境中,工作人员往往需要处理大量的文档和数据,数据清洗能够帮助识别和纠正输入错误,提高数据输入的准确性。例如,在使用ChatGPT进行文本生成或数据分析时,确保输入数据的质量能够显著提升输出结果的可靠性。

3. 提高决策支持系统的有效性

智能办公系统通常依赖于数据分析来支持决策。通过对历史数据的清洗和处理,决策支持系统可以提供更加准确和科学的数据分析结果,帮助管理层做出更为明智的决策。

4. 优化业务流程

数据清洗可以帮助企业优化业务流程。通过分析清洗后的数据,企业能够识别出流程中的瓶颈和问题,从而进行相应的改进,提升整体效率。

5. 提升客户关系管理

在客户关系管理(CRM)系统中,数据清洗可以确保客户信息的准确性和一致性,从而提升客户服务质量和客户满意度。

七、数据清洗的挑战与未来发展

尽管数据清洗在各个领域的应用越来越广泛,但仍然面临一些挑战:

  • 数据量激增:随着大数据技术的发展,数据量不断增加,如何高效处理海量数据成为一大挑战。
  • 数据多样性:数据来源多样,格式各异,清洗过程中的标准化和统一化难度加大。
  • 实时性要求:在智能办公等场景中,数据处理要求实时性较高,如何平衡清洗质量与处理速度是一个难题。
  • 工具与技术更新:随着技术的发展,新的数据处理工具和算法不断涌现,如何有效应用这些新技术也是一个挑战。

未来,随着人工智能、机器学习和自动化技术的发展,数据清洗将朝着更高效、智能化的方向发展。自动化数据清洗工具的出现,将大幅减少人工干预,提高数据处理的效率和准确性。同时,数据清洗的标准化和规范化也将为行业的发展提供更加可靠的基础。

八、总结

数据清洗作为数据分析过程中不可或缺的一环,具有深远的意义和广泛的应用。通过对数据的清洗和处理,企业和组织能够提升数据质量,增强决策的科学性,最终实现业务的优化和提升。展望未来,数据清洗技术将继续演进,为大数据和人工智能的发展提供强有力的支持。

在智能办公和AI等新兴领域中,数据清洗的作用愈发重要。企业需要重视数据清洗的过程和方法,结合适当的工具与技术,以确保数据的准确性和可靠性,为业务的发展打下坚实的基础。

免责声明:本站所提供的内容均来源于网友提供或网络分享、搜集,由本站编辑整理,仅供个人研究、交流学习使用。如涉及版权问题,请联系本站管理员予以更改或删除。
上一篇:数据分析
下一篇:数据聚类分析

添加企业微信

1V1服务,高效匹配老师
欢迎各种培训合作扫码联系,我们将竭诚为您服务
本课程名称:/

填写信息,即有专人与您沟通